Output c26a51ea06f99587b642f775392c803aee73d6038a9309d708a1bfd0b92cb6d8:1

value
45799987556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b168ed4cb20eee866c92c7f2fe4fe9c5754f075a OP_EQUAL
address
3Hs5Dx4XWJDbKmhCotXDNFdUb7jRY4pZVw
transaction
c26a51ea06f99587b642f775392c803aee73d6038a9309d708a1bfd0b92cb6d8